Why Proper Site Preparation Matters

Even quality concrete can perform poorly when the foundation beneath it is not prepared correctly. Site preparation is one of the most important parts of driveway construction because it supports the entire surface.

Preparing The Ground Correctly

Before concrete is placed, the contractor should assess the existing ground and prepare the area according to site conditions. Removing unsuitable material, creating a stable base, and establishing proper levels can help reduce future surface problems.

A skilled Driveway Installer Galveston TX pays close attention to grading and soil conditions. The goal is to create a firm foundation that can handle everyday vehicle traffic and changing weather.

Planning For Water Drainage

Water management should also be part of the design. Standing water can affect the driveway surface and surrounding property. Proper grading helps guide rainwater away from unwanted areas.

For Galveston homeowners, drainage deserves special attention because heavy rainfall can quickly expose weaknesses in poor site preparation. A contractor who considers water flow from the beginning is more likely to deliver a driveway that performs well through different seasons.

Quality Materials And Careful Workmanship

Professional driveway construction depends on both materials and the way those materials are handled. Choosing suitable concrete and using proper installation methods can influence strength, appearance, and service life.

Selecting Suitable Concrete

A reputable Driveway Installer Galveston TX considers the driveway's expected traffic, size, location, and surrounding conditions before recommending materials. The right concrete mix should match the needs of the property rather than being selected simply because it is convenient.

Material quality also affects the finished appearance. Consistent texture, clean edges, and an even surface can give a driveway a polished look that complements the home.

Paying Attention To Finishing Details

Workmanship becomes especially visible during the finishing stage. Professional installers take care with edges, joints, surface texture, and overall consistency.

Concrete also needs appropriate time to set and gain strength. Rushing the process can affect the final result. A dependable contractor follows proper installation practices rather than trying to finish every project as quickly as possible.
